CASE STUDY

John is a 46 year old man, married with two children.

He initially complained of increasing weakness in his legs.  Always an anxious man, at first this was put down to stress.  When the weakness worsened, however, investigations and examination suggested motor neurone disease, and subsequent progression of the signs and symptoms has confirmed the diagnosis.  He wanted to know the diagnosis and was told

He is normally anxious, but ready to chat and animated.  Today he seems distant and speaks to you in brief sentences or single words.
